“Chile’s Fintech Law requires adjustments to address the challenges of the bitcoin market”

November 30, 2024 7 Min Read
Share
“Chile's Fintech Law requires adjustments to address the challenges of the bitcoin market”
  • The trade has demonstrated “resilience” by surviving in a hostile monetary atmosphere.

  • Cryptocurrencies in Chile are used for remittances, digital commerce and technological companies.

Chile’s Fintech Regulation, which has been in drive for nearly two years, has been a big advance concerning the regulation of bitcoin (BTC) and cryptocurrencies in that nation. Nevertheless, that customary must be adjusted in order that it covers all of the challenges that contain the rising market.

That is what María Fernanda Juppet, government director of the Chilean cryptocurrency trade CryptoMKT, considers, who in an interview with CriptoNoticias acknowledged that This rule “is a step ahead” for the sectorhowever “there are nonetheless areas that require changes to handle the precise challenges of the cryptocurrency market.”

Amongst these areas, he highlights “the necessity for clear definitions of digital belongings and the creation of rules that promote innovation with out proscribing it.” The manager believes that “a continuing dialogue between regulators, corporations and specialists is vital to growing a regulatory framework that balances safety and innovation.”

Juppet’s imaginative and prescient concerning the changes that should be made to the Fintech Regulation coincide with that of Sebastián Ovalle, compliance officer of the corporate Fintual, who considers that this regulation has detrimental elements, such because the excessive calls for it establishes for corporations stay operational.

Even so, the businesswoman Juppet maintains that this regulation, which got here into drive in February 2023, It’s a path in direction of a “extra collaborative” monetary ecosystem. He thinks that this laws, with every little thing and the changes it requires, “promotes monetary inclusion and establishes a framework that ought to permit corporations within the sector to work extra carefully with conventional banks.”

“I imagine that this relationship will evolve in direction of cooperation fashions, the place cryptocurrencies complement conventional monetary companies, selling higher integration and belief within the system,” he stated.

Thus, he agreed with Samuel Cañas, president of the FinteChile Affiliation, who affirms that one thing optimistic about this regulation is that it permits the trade to have a regulation that offers “certainty” to each purchasers and entrepreneurs.

Working with “resilience”

Now, this situation, the place there’s collaboration between each ecosystems, remains to be growing in Chile. In that nation, the banks They’ve an unwavering place to not work with corporations of cryptocurrencies.

In 2018, CryptoMKT, which is likely one of the predominant bitcoin and cryptocurrency exchanges in Latin America, with a presence in Argentina, Brazil, Colombia, Peru, in addition to Chile, together with different platforms within the sector, equivalent to Buda.com and OrionX; They sued a number of banking companies in Chile for closing their accounts, as reported by CriptoNoticias.

Nevertheless, in December 2023, the Court docket for the Protection of Free Competitors (TDLC) dominated towards these platforms and sided in favor of the banks. As Juppet put it, this “was a serious setback in our seek for a fairer and extra aggressive atmosphere for fintech in Chile.”

“Nevertheless, this determination has not stopped us. “Now we have strengthened our compliance and transparency insurance policies, which has allowed us to take care of relationships of belief with different monetary establishments,” he stated.

Nevertheless, Juppet acknowledges that working in an atmosphere the place banks have determined to shut their doorways to bitcoin and cryptocurrency corporations “has been a substantial problem.” Keep in mind that, in your organization, this case of closures and restrictions affected its operations considerably.

“This restricted our potential to supply complete monetary companies and generated uncertainty within the fintech ecosystem in Chile,” the businesswoman recalled.

“Nevertheless, we’ve got demonstrated resilience by implementing methods equivalent to diversifying monetary alliances and in search of alternate options to make sure operational continuity. Though it has not been simple, we stay targeted on offering modern options to our customers and strengthening our place available in the market.”

María Fernanda Juppet, government director of the CryptoMKT trade.

Intensifying the dialogue

The directive revealed that the cryptocurrency trade firm has intensified dialogue with regulators and sector gamers to advertise regulation “that encourages truthful competitors and market growth.”

He claims that this expertise has taught them to adapt rapidly and innovate in options. “Which permits us to proceed rising and including worth to the cryptocurrency ecosystem,” he stated.

For Juppet, Chile, though it has proven essential advances in regulation, doesn’t examine with Brazil or Mexico, which “have adopted extra proactive approaches, together with the combination of digital belongings into their regulatory frameworks.”

The manager says {that a} good observe to information that nation in direction of satisfactory regulation for the sector is to “foster areas for public-private collaboration to ensure that rules adapt to native and world realities.” In addition to, the implementation of regulatory “sandboxes”as in Brazil, could possibly be key to encouraging innovation in Chile, he assured.

The board feedback that in Chile the adoption of cryptocurrencies as a way of fee has grown steadily, “pushed by the necessity for extra inclusive and environment friendly monetary options.” He additionally explains that in that nation there was a notable enhance in its use for remittances, digital commerce and technological companies.

“Sectors equivalent to tourism and expertise are main this transformation, making the most of some great benefits of cryptocurrencies to scale back prices and enhance buyer expertise. Chile, particularly, is advancing quickly due to higher digitalization and openness to new monetary applied sciences,” he stated.

Juppet’s imaginative and prescient is configured in a situation wherein the Fintech Regulation, which in February will have a good time two years of its entry into drive, be up to date because the bitcoin and cryptocurrency ecosystem advances.

A coherent perspective contemplating that the market is not the identical in comparison with 2023. There are new areas to handle If the actual purpose is to create an area for collaboration and integration between the Bitcoin ecosystem and the legacy monetary system.
